Is 6 MOA or 3 MOA better?

A 6 MOA larger dot is best for shorter ranges while the smaller dot of 3 MOA is better for longer or more distant shots.

What is the best size MOA?

The most popular MOA size for a pistol-mounted red dot sight is a 6 MOA reticle. The reason you might want to use a 6 MOA on a pistol is because it’s easy to find the red dot when you draw and look through the glass, which allows for quicker target acquisition.

Why put a red dot on a pistol?

Removing sight alignment from the sighting equation streamlines the aiming process and makes it much more intuitive for the human eye. Red dots also make the shooter more acutely aware of the point of aim and transfer a lot more intuitive feedback to the shooter. The dot doesn’t lie.

Does the Vortex Venom and Viper have the same mount? Do the Vortex Viper and Venom have the same footprint? No, the Vortex Viper and the Vortex Venom do not have the same footprint, they do have the same bolt pattern for the mounting bolts through the optic that can go either directly into the custom cut pistol or onto a mount as well.

How long does the Vortex Venom stay on? Battery Life: Up to 150 hours on highest setting. Up to 30,000 hours on lower settings.

How long does the Vortex Viper red dot stay on? Battery Life: Up to 150 hours on highest setting.

Is Vortex Crossfire II vs Diamondback?

The bottom line is that the Crossfire II gives you a faster locational target acquisition, while the Diamondback gives you a wider field of view, so the Crossfire II would be a great sit back and target and range scope, while the Diamondback would be a better moving hunting and tactical scope.

What is V Plex reticle?

Vortex V-Plex Reticle

The V-Plex is a MOA based reticle that is basically Vortex’s version of the standard duplex reticle. It features slightly wider and darker horizontal and vertical posts, that narrow down to a finer line with a duplex-based crosshair.
